Kroger is the latest company to discontinue its weekly circular ads. “The loss of the Kroger circulars is a loss for both the paper and our readers,” said the publisher of The Mississippi Dispatch in Columbus, Mississippi. The move also hurts newspapers that rely on advertisements for dwindling revenue.

This means that millions of older and low-income shoppers - the people who often depend on promotions the most to stretch their dollars - will be shut out of online deals. Additionally, 24% of adults with household incomes below $30,000 a year don’t own a smartphone, while 41% don’t have a computer. “It also leaves behind those folks without internet access or smartphones.”Īccording to Pew Research Center, 39% of people 65 and over do not own a smartphone, and 25% don’t use the internet. “This becomes inconvenient for shoppers who, up until now, could do easy comparison shopping just by flipping the pages of competing stores’ circulars at their kitchen table,” said Edgar Dworsky, a consumer advocate and founder of Consumer World. It also comes amid a jump in grocery prices.Ī Stanford University study in 2006 found that at least 10% of shoppers chose their store based on the week’s ads, and that shoppers were most influenced when the ads promoted discounts on cereal, chips, pizza, cookies and hot dogs. The move could deal a blow to shoppers who plan their store trips based on weekly newspaper ads.
